Abstract
    The investigation includes measurements of primary production in situ, light extinction at 450 nm, 522 nm, 583 nm and 653 nm, and phytoplankton composition at one station in Straumsbukta (60° 33 . 5'N, 18° 37'E) at four different seasons. Primary production varied with a factor of 10 SUP-13 from winter to summer, and production in summer was at noon 60 times that of midnight. Size fractions passing a 5 mu m nylon net conributed with 6% (summer) - 73% (winter) of the production in surface water samples. Nanoplankton flagellates, Phaeocystis pouchetii, Chaetoceros debilis and Coccolithus (Emiliania) huxleyi were the main phytoplankton species in December, April, July and September, respectively.
